mod read;
mod refresh;
use super::commands::{topology_command, topology_usage};
use crate::{
cli::{clap::parse_required_subcommand_or_usage, help::print_help_or_version_flag},
nns::NnsCommandError,
version_text,
};
use std::ffi::OsString;
pub(in crate::nns) fn run<I>(args: I) -> Result<(), NnsCommandError>
where
I: IntoIterator<Item = OsString>,
{
let args = args.into_iter().collect::<Vec<_>>();
if print_help_or_version_flag(&args, topology_usage, version_text()) {
return Ok(());
}
let (command, args) =
parse_required_subcommand_or_usage(topology_command(), args, topology_usage)
.map_err(NnsCommandError::Usage)?;
match command.as_str() {
"summary" => read::run_topology_summary(args),
"coverage" => read::run_topology_coverage(args),
"versions" => read::run_topology_versions(args),
"health" => read::run_topology_health(args),
"gaps" => read::run_topology_gaps(args),
"capacity" => read::run_topology_capacity(args),
"regions" => read::run_topology_regions(args),
"providers" => read::run_topology_providers(args),
"refresh" => refresh::run_topology_refresh(args),
_ => unreachable!("nns topology dispatch command only defines known commands"),
}
}
